Action item from the Fernwick outage review: the docs linter (Proselint-ish thing we call Quibbler) was silently skipping files with non-ASCII headings, which is how the stale key-rotation guide shipped. We've patched the parser, but please eyeball the skip-list logic from a security angle — it also gates which pages get the confidentiality banner. The audit checklist and diff summary are on the internal page below.

operations page: https://jenkins.zemvarcloud.local/job/merge_requests/repo/build/73930b4b30f0a8ed

Meeting notes — Branch Server Replacement (Ashford Lane office)

Attendees agreed the replacement server from Norwick Systems ships Monday. The unit stays in its padded transit crate, upright, with the shock indicator visible. Shift lead to verify the indicator is untripped before release and record the crate seal in the log. When the Pellbrook courier arrives, relay the following instruction at hand-over.

dispatch memo: the lamwyn fenwyn courier leaves the wenir ledger at gate 7175 under passcode 822969

// Canary gating for the Oakmire deploy pipeline. The client below polls
// the Veltrace metrics service every 30s and blocks promotion if error
// rate exceeds 0.5% or p99 latency regresses more than 15% versus
// baseline. If you're on call and a canary is stuck, check the gate
// verdict endpoint before overriding — forced promotions are logged and
// reviewed. The Veltrace client authenticates with a single service key,
// which belongs directly under this comment:

gateway credential: kto23_LX9A4ys6i4nzHtpOLNLodKK

MEMO — Offsite Tape Rotation

To the driver's coordinator: the weekly backup tapes from the Crowhurst data room are cased, labeled, and logged by close of business Wednesday. The case remains sealed in transit and rides in the cab, never the cargo bed. On arrival at the Veldt Street vault, the driver must follow the instruction below exactly.

handover note for yagef-bagep: the drudor pelius courier leaves the kasdor zorvan norir ledger at gate 8016 under passcode 755406